Top Safety Award for Northern Gas Mains Company

APRIL 16, 2008

The company which looks after the North of England’s gas mains has won a prestigious safety award from the Royal Society for the Prevention of Accidents (RoSPA).

United Utilities, which runs the region’s 36,000km gas main network on behalf of Northern Gas Networks, earned a RoSPA Gold Award for occupational health and safety. The company has offices and depots across the region including North Tyneside, Sunderland, Middlesbrough, York, Hull, Leeds and Heckmondwike.

The award will be presented officially at a ceremony in Birmingham on May 13.

David Rawlins, RoSPA Awards Manager, said: “United Utilities has shown a commitment to protecting the health and well-being of its employees and others. We hope other businesses and organisations will follow its lead and strive for continuous improvement in health and safety management.”

As well as keeping the gas flowing to 2.5 million homes and businesses across the North of England, United Utilities runs the region’s gas emergency service on behalf of Northern Gas Networks.

Its 1,200 staff also manage Northern Gas Networks’ annual £60m gas mains investment programme which replaces 528km of old metal pipe with modern plastic pipe every year.

“It’s our job to keep Northern Gas Networks’ system safe and reliable for the millions of people in our region who rely on it,” said United Utilities’ Health and Safety Manager Peter Christie. “Safety is always top of our list and it’s great that independent experts at RoSPA have acknowledged the quality of our safety record and our systems.”

The RoSPA Occupational Health and Safety Awards 2008 are sponsored by NEBOSH (The National Examination Board in Occupational Health and Safety), the leading health and safety professional body.

They are not just about reducing the number of accidents and cases of ill-health at work, they help to ensure that organisations have good health and safety management systems in place.
